Relating to mental health services; declaring an emergency.
Summary
Requires Department of Human Services and Oregon Health Authority to ensure that individual receiving mental health services under 1915(i) state plan amendment does not lose any mental health services when individual begins receiving services under 1915(k) state plan amendment. Requires department to notify individual of right to continued receipt of mental health services. Declares emergency, effective on passage.
